模块cpuidearly是一个计算机编程中常用的模块,它主要用于在系统启动时初始化CPU,并在CPU可用之前执行必要的操作。该模块通常被称为“早期CPU初始化模块”,因为它是在操作系统内核启动之前执行的。
在计算机启动时,CPU需要被初始化,以便能够正确地执行指令和操作系统代码。模块cpuidearly就是为了实现这个目的而设计的。这个模块会在系统启动时被加载,并在CPU初始化之前执行必要的操作,比如设置寄存器、设置中断向量表等。这些操作将确保CPU能够正确地执行指令,并为操作系统内核的加载做好准备。
一旦CPU初始化完成,模块cpuidearly的工作就完成了。此时,操作系统内核将开始加载,并开始执行其他必要的操作。这些操作包括加载驱动程序、初始化设备等。
总的来说,模块cpuidearly是计算机编程中非常重要的一个模块,它确保了CPU在系统启动时能够正确地初始化,并为操作系统内核的加载做好准备。如果CPU没有被正确地初始化,那么操作系统将无法正常运行。因此,程序员们必须认真地编写和调试模块cpuidearly,以确保操作系统的正常运行。